SDT might have a slight advantage. I know when I rushed I was concerned about $$ and having to live in the house. No offense to anyone, but sharing a bathroom with that many girls scares me to death (I have bathroom issues)

Some girls that might not go greek might consider a less expensive sorority and older girls might enjoy not having to give up their apartments

Recs never hurt. If your area has a local APA then she should register with them by all means. Many APAs hold information sessions at this time of year. Some are already over but it doesn't hurt to check it out. Good luck to your sister!

I think maybe they are doing this to tell the PNMs that black is what is usually worn, but any color is acceptable. Black dress is not required, but everyone thinks of black for more formal attire. It's always easier to remember a PNM who 'stands out' in her bright red dress or whatever, as opposed to those many women wearing black. Neither is necessarily a help or a hindrance......
